Farm credit States - Andhra Pradesh Loan-waiver scheme sought for AP ryots
Ch. R.S. Sarma Guntur, July 30 The Union Government and the Andhra Pradesh Government should make an earnest attempt to solve the problem of rural indebtedness by formulating and implementing a loan waiver scheme for small and marginal farmers in the State, numbering 1 crore, said Dr Y. Sivaji, former member of the Rajya Sabha and president of AP Tobacco Farmers’ Association. In a statement issued here on Monday, he said that as the Prime Minister, Dr Manmohan Singh, would be reviewing the progress of agriculture in the State in Hyderabad along with the Chief Minister and the officials of the Agriculture Department on Tuesday, the issue should be given prominence. “The step is absolutely essential to prevent large-scale suicides of farmers in the State,” he said.
